About the position We are seeking a Climate Mitigation Planner who will support Rincon’s Sustainability Climate Resilience (SCR+) Practice in developing climate action plans, decarbonization strategies, and greenhouse gas modeling; then working with those clients to implement their projects throughout California, some of which are the first of their kind. Rincon’s SCR+ Practice works with cities, counties, special agencies, and businesses throughout California on a wide range of climate areas including carbon neutrality, electrification and decarbonization, water and waste issues, transportation, urban planning, carbon intensity analysis and low carbon fuel and greenhouse gas verification. This position will require strong technical analysis and data management skills, strong communication and writing skills, an entrepreneurial spirit, and a good working knowledge of the climate action planning process and climate legislation in California. Responsibilities

  • Manipulate and utilize energy, transportation, and other types of data to calculate greenhouse gas emissions consistent with the Local Governments for Sustainability’s (ICLEI) Community Protocol and the GHG Protocol for Community-scale Greenhouse Gas Emission Inventories.
  • Audit greenhouse gas emissions and fuel data to verify reports against the California Air Resources Board’s (CARB) Mandatory Greehouse Gas Reporting Regulation and Low Carbon Fuel Standard.
  • Utilize various quantitative modeling methods to model short- and long-term greenhouse gas emissions reductions, implementation costs, electricity demand, and other impacts
  • Research and develop strategies to help communities mitigate greenhouse gas emissions through renewable energy and storage, building electrification, transportation electrification, vehicle miles traveled reduction, organic waste diversion, and other strategies.
  • Prepare drafts of technical memoranda, reports, presentations, and other written materials
  • Assist with the preparation and design of climate action plans, building decarbonization plans, sustainability plans, and other documents
  • Communicate complicated scientific and climate-related topics to diverse communities and stakeholders
  • Connect climate mitigation, resilience, and environmental justice policies through policy development
  • Work independently and as a team to develop solutions for quantitative and qualitative problems
  • Interact with various members of public agency and private client staff on matters of sustainability and climate action
